Church roof replacement services involve removing an existing roof structure and installing a new roofing system to ensure the building remains protected from the elements. The process typically includes inspecting the current roof, removing damaged or outdated materials, and installing new components such as shingles, metal panels, or other roofing materials suited to the building’s design and function. This service is essential for maintaining the integrity of church buildings, which often feature large, complex rooflines that require specialized attention during replacement.
Replacing a church roof addresses several common problems, including leaks, structural deterioration, and damage caused by weather events or age. Over time, exposure to rain, snow, wind, and temperature fluctuations can compromise roofing materials, leading to water infiltration and potential interior damage. A roof replacement helps prevent costly repairs to the building’s interior and supports the safety of congregants and staff by ensuring the roof remains stable and secure.

Typical Costs - The cost for church roof replacement services can vary widely based on size and materials, generally ranging from $50,000 to $150,000 for a complete overhaul. Smaller churches may see prices closer to $30,000, while larger facilities could exceed $200,000.
Material Expenses - The choice of roofing materials impacts the overall cost significantly. Asphalt shingles might cost between $3 and $5 per square foot, whereas metal roofing can range from $7 to $12 per square foot, affecting the total project budget.
Labor Costs - Labor expenses typically account for 50% or more of the total replacement cost, with local contractor rates in Asheville, NC, averaging between $40 and $80 per hour. Larger projects may require extensive labor, increasing overall costs.
Additional Fees - Extra costs may include permits, debris removal, and structural repairs, which can add $5,000 to $20,000 or more to the total price, depending on the project's scope and compl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Steeple and Tower Roof Replacement projects target the unique roofing needs of church steeples and towers, requiring skilled contractors to handle height and architectural complexity. These services help preserve the church’s traditional appearance and structural safety.
Flat Roof Replacement services are tailored for churches with flat roofing systems, offering solutions to address drainage problems, membrane deterioration, and weather resistance. Local pros ensure proper installation for long-term performance.
